EU May Exempt Pensions From Derivs Rules

European pension funds are likely to get reprieve from new European Union regulations governing derivatives trading, Financial News reports. The U.K. Treasury, which is in talks with authorities to ease the impact of the rule, is expected to win a three-year exemption from the rules. As per the new rules, the majority of deals will have to be cleared via a central counterparty and assets will need to be pledged as collateral. Pension schemes along with property firms, real estate investment funds and insurance firms are seeking an exemption from the clearing requirement.
